Synthesis and characterization of hexakis(alkyl isocyanide) and hexakis(aryl isocyanide) complexes of technetium(I)

The complexes, hexakis(alkyl isocyanide) technetium(I) hexafluorophosphate (Tc(CNR)/sub 6/)PF/sub 6/ (where R = tert-butyl, methyl, cyclohexyl, and phenyl), have been prepared by reduction of the pertechnetate ion with aqueous sodium dithionite (Na/sub 2/S/sub 2/O/sub 4/) in the presence of the isocyanide ligands. These complexes have been characterized by elemental analysis, optical, ir, and /sup 1/H NMR spectroscopy, conductance, cyclic voltammetry, and field desorption mass spectrometry.
